Working at one of the nation’s largest bullion dealers, there is no doubt in my mind – nor that of Andy Schectman, Miles Franklin’s President and co-founder – that a 2008-like Precious Metals’ shortage, especially in silver, is heading for us like a runaway train; as the aforementioned “terrifying trio” of record, exploding demand; dramatically depleting, record-low inventories; and inevitable, historic production declines are at this point, “set in stone.”

Regarding the former, I’m not sure I can emphasize more how powerfully demand has surged this year – and particularly this summer – the world round.  Regarding gold, Chinese gold deliveries on Wednesday alone were a staggering 19.2 tonnes – or three times the entire, collapsing inventory of COMEX registered gold.  Meanwhile, as long-time industry guru Peter Hambro claimed “it’s virtually impossible to get physical gold in London, to ship to India,” the CEO of the LBMA, or London Bullion Market Association, revealed there are just “500,000 bars in the London vaults, worth ~$237 billion.”  Which is what the ECB is printing every four months – amidst growing rumors that it is considering expanding the pace of its thus far miserably failed QE scheme.

Here in the States, this interview with the CEO of one of the largest U.S. Mints – the Sunshine Mint – depicts an industry splitting at the seams with exploding silver demand.  Not to mention, an equally dramatic plunge in COMEX silver inventories.  As for India, which before its insane government initiated prohibitive PM import tariffs two years ago – spawning the creation of a massive, tax avoiding “black market” – was the world’s largest physical PM importer; not only has its official gold demand (excluding the black market) rebounded to nearly its all-time high pace; but after an explosive August, Indian silver imports are literally going parabolic.

Which begs the question – as physical silver premiums measurably increased this week – where future supply will come from, as demand continues to surge, and above-ground inventories virtually exhaust?  Let alone, as collapsing base metal prices portend massive mine closures; as don’t forget, essentially half of all silver production is the byproduct of copper, lead, and zinc mines?

To that end, I’m not going to write my thousandth article about how dire the situation is for the collapsing mining industry.  By now, anyone can see that mining stocks are trading at all-time lows, amidst a horrific combination of ugly finances, hemorrhaging operations, rapidly depleting assets, and the specter of massive, catastrophic, balance sheet destroying write-offs in the coming months.  The first to go will be miners with the highest cost bases – such as essentially the entire South African mining industry, as illustrated by the Rand closing the week at an all-time low.  And next, those with questionably accounted for “assets” – such as the “measured, indicated, and inferred resources” I described earlier this year as at best “arbitrary guesses,” and at worst fraudulent.  Which, either way, at current, historically suppressed prices – way below the marginal cost of production, and WAY below the cost of long-term industry sustainability – is a moot point, as everything not nailed down is about to be written off, permanently, into the accounting ether.  And with said write-downs, the ensuing bankruptcies; capital expenditures reductions; mine closures; and debilitating, dilutive mergers they will spawn will be a sight to behold.  And more importantly, they will herald the guaranteed “peak gold” and peak silver the Miles Franklin Blog has predicted for years.
